Interior design is the art and science of improving the interiors, sometimes including the exterior, of a space or building, to achieve a wholesome and even more desirable environment for the end user aesthetically. An interior designer is someone who plans, researches, coordinates, and manages such projects. Home design is a multifaceted job which includes conceptual development, space planning, site inspections, development, research, communicating with the stakeholders of any project, development management, and execution of the look.

Home design is the process of shaping the knowledge of interior space, through the manipulation of spatial amount as well as surface treatment for the betterment of real human functionality.

Interior designer means that there exists more of an focus on planning, useful design and the effective use of space, as compared to interior decorating. An interior designer can undertake projects including arranging the essential layout of spaces in a building as well as assignments that require a knowledge of specialized issues such as windows and door setting, acoustics, and light. Although an interior designer might create the design of a space, they might not alter load-bearing wall surfaces with no their designs stamped for acceptance by the structural engineer. Interior designers work immediately with architects often, contractors and engineers.

Interior designers must be highly skilled in order to set-up interior conditions that are efficient, safe, and stick to building codes, regulations and ADA requirements. Each goes beyond selecting color palettes and furnishings and apply their knowledge to the introduction of construction documents, occupancy loads, healthcare regulations and sustainable design principles, as well as the coordination and management of professional services including mechanical, electrical, plumbing, and life safety--all to ensure that individuals can live, learn or work in an innocuous environment that is aesthetically satisfying also.

Someone may wish to focus and develop technical knowledge specific to one area or type of interior design, such as personal design, commercial design, hospitality design, health care design, universal design, exhibition design, furniture design, and spatial branding. Interior design is an innovative vocation that is relatively new, constantly evolving, and frequently baffling to the public. It isn't an artistic pursuit and depends on research from many fields to provide a well-trained understanding of how people are influenced by their environments.

Color in interior design

Color is a powerful design tool in decorating, and interior design which is the creative skill of structure, and coordinates colors jointly to produce stylish plan. Interior designers have understanding of colors to comprehend psychological effects, and meaning of each color to create suitable combinations for each and every accepted place. Combining Color gives a certain state of mind also, and has positive and negative effects. It makes a available room feel more calm, cheerful, comfortable or dramatic. It makes a tiny room seem larger or smaller also. So it is the inside designer profession to choose appropriate colors for a place in ways people want to appear and feel in the space.

Home Insurance Tips

Homeowners' insurance is not a luxury, it's essential. In fact, most mortgage loan companies won't make financing or financing a personal real estate business deal unless the buyer provides proof coverage for the entire or good value of the property (most of the time this is actually the purchase price). In this article, we'll show you some simple activities you may take to be sure your homeowners' insurance is enough to your requirements.

Homeowners' insurance can be quite expensive. The ones that live in high-risk areas such as close to major waterways, known earthquake mistake lines or other high says areas can pay the most for coverage. Actually, those in high-risk areas tend to be forced to pay twelve-monthly premiums in the many thousands. But even homeowners in relatively sedate, suburban neighborhoods (with property prices around the national average of $210,000) could pay between $500 and $1,000 a full year for a simple coverage.

The good news is that although you can't (and shouldn't) avoid purchasing homeowners' insurance, there are ways to reduce the cost.

Listed below are six ways to be sure you find the right coverage and consequent compensation for your home:

1) Maintain a Security System and Smoke cigars Alarms: A security alarm that is watched by the central station, or that is linked right to a local police stop, will help lower the homeowner's annual prices, perhaps by 5% or more. To be able to have the discount, the owner of a house must typically provide proof of central monitoring by means of a charge or a agreement to the insurance company.Smoke cigarettes alarms are another biggie. While standard in most modern houses, setting up them in more mature homes can save the homeowner 10% or even more in annual premiums. Of course, more importantly even, in case there is flame, they could save your valuable life!

2) Raise Your Deductible: Like medical health insurance or auto insurance, the higher the deductible the home owner chooses, the lower the annual rates. However, the challenge with selecting a high deductible is the fact that smaller claims/problems such as broken windows or destroyed sheetrock from a leaky pipe, which typically will cost only a few hundred dollars to fix, will likely be utilized by the property owner.

3) Search for Multiple Policy Special discounts: Many insurance firms provide a discount of 10% or even more with their customers that maintain other insurance deals under the same roof (such as auto or medical health insurance). Consider finding a quote for other types of insurance from the same company that delivers your homeowners' insurance. You may wrap up saving on two annual policy premiums.

4) Plan Ahead for Structure: If the homeowner plans to build an addition to the house or another framework adjacent to the home, she or he should think about the materials which will be used. Typically, wood-framed structures (because they're highly flammable) will cost more to insure. Conversely, concrete- or steel-framed buildings will definitely cost less because it is less inclined to succumb to flame or adverse weather conditions.

Another simple thing that a lot of homeowners should, but often don't, consider is the insurance charges associated with building a swimming pool. In fact, items such as private pools and/or other probably injurious devices (like trampolines) can drive total annual homeowners' insurance costs up by 10% or more. This may seem like a tiny price to pay given the delight these things bring, but it continues to be something that needs to be considered by the homeowner prior to buy or construction.

5) PAY BACK Your Mortgage: Clearly this is easier said than done, but homeowners that pay off their home loan debt shall most likely see their rates drop. Why? The easy reason is that the insurance company characters that if you own the real home outright, you'll take better attention of it.

6) Make Regular Insurance policy Reviews and Evaluations: Buyers should, at least once per calendar year, compare the expenses of other insurance policies to their own. Furthermore, they ought to review their existing coverage and make word of any changes that may have occurred that could lower their monthly premiums.

For example, the home owner has disassembled the trampoline perhaps, paid the home loan, installed a burglar alarm or installed a superior sprinkler system inside his or her home. If this is the full circumstance, simply notifying the insurance company of the change(s) and providing proofs by means of pictures and/or receipts could significantly lower insurance costs.Search for changes in the neighborhood that could reduce rates as well. For example, the installation of a fireplace hydrant within 100 feet of the home, or the erection of your open fire substation within close proximity to the property may lower the homeowner's gross annual premiums.
